summary refs log tree commit diff
path: root/pkgs/development/interpreters/clojure
diff options
context:
space:
mode:
authorHerwig Hochleitner <herwig@bendlas.net>2018-12-22 02:33:18 +0100
committerHerwig Hochleitner <herwig@bendlas.net>2018-12-22 02:41:42 +0100
commitf097a16992915f778e68bb0c7c841185e0033182 (patch)
tree993cf014082f803050564a24178b451e4a69fe6d /pkgs/development/interpreters/clojure
parent62aea9510c81ca85a500b1814e7f978c3285fb7f (diff)
downloadnixpkgs-f097a16992915f778e68bb0c7c841185e0033182.tar
nixpkgs-f097a16992915f778e68bb0c7c841185e0033182.tar.gz
nixpkgs-f097a16992915f778e68bb0c7c841185e0033182.tar.bz2
nixpkgs-f097a16992915f778e68bb0c7c841185e0033182.tar.lz
nixpkgs-f097a16992915f778e68bb0c7c841185e0033182.tar.xz
nixpkgs-f097a16992915f778e68bb0c7c841185e0033182.tar.zst
nixpkgs-f097a16992915f778e68bb0c7c841185e0033182.zip
clojure: add $out/bin to wrapper PATH
without this, the `clj` command calls into system path, instead of its
own `clojure` command

cc @the-kenny
Diffstat (limited to 'pkgs/development/interpreters/clojure')
-rw-r--r--pkgs/development/interpreters/clojure/default.nix4
1 files changed, 2 insertions, 2 deletions
diff --git a/pkgs/development/interpreters/clojure/default.nix b/pkgs/development/interpreters/clojure/default.nix
index 33b5551a3d6..001f7c9abee 100644
--- a/pkgs/development/interpreters/clojure/default.nix
+++ b/pkgs/development/interpreters/clojure/default.nix
@@ -23,8 +23,8 @@ stdenv.mkDerivation rec {
     substituteInPlace clojure --replace PREFIX $prefix
 
     install -Dt $out/bin clj clojure
-    wrapProgram $out/bin/clj --prefix PATH : ${binPath}
-    wrapProgram $out/bin/clojure --prefix PATH : ${binPath}
+    wrapProgram $out/bin/clj --prefix PATH : $out/bin:${binPath}
+    wrapProgram $out/bin/clojure --prefix PATH : $out/bin:${binPath}
   '';
 
   meta = with stdenv.lib; {